
The eagerly anticipated cast for Sam Mendes’ quartet of Beatles biopics has been unveiled, causing a stir among fans.
Harris Dickinson is set to embody John Lennon, Paul Mescal will step into the shoes of Paul McCartney, Barry Keoghan will be seen as Ringo Starr, while Joseph Quinn takes on the persona of George Harrison. The director confirmed his ambitious project of four individual films, each dedicated to a single Beatle, is slated to hit the screens in April 2028.

Harris Dickinson, aged 28 and a British actor, first cut his teeth on British TV before breaking through in his lead role in the drama film ‘Beach Rats’. He has since starred in major movies such as Where the Crawdads Sing (2022) and Babygirl (2024).
Paul Mescal,29 , is an Irish actor who shot to fame with his role in the BBC mini-series Normal People. He also featured in the blockbuster sequel Gladiator II in 2024.
Barry Keoghan, another Irish actor aged 32, has made a name for himself in both television and film. His notable roles include Oliver Quick in the thriller Saltburn, available on Amazon Prime, and a part in the final season of Netflix‘s Top Boy in 2023.
He also made headlines for his relationship with renowned American singer-songwriter Sabrina Carpenter. English actor Joseph Quinn, 31, is best known for his role as Eddie Munson in the fourth series of Netflix‘s hit show Stranger Things.
He joined Paul Mescal in the cast of Gladiator II, playing Emperor Geta. His other credits include the horror film A Quiet Place: Day One, and the BBC One series Dickensian and Les Misérables.
The Beatles, a legendary rock band formed in Liverpool in 1960, continue to be celebrated for their timeless hits like Here Comes The Sun, Let It Be and Hey Jude. The band consisted of co-lead vocalist and rhythm guitarist John Lennon, bass guitarist Paul McCartney who shared primary songwriting and lead vocal duties with John, lead guitarist George Harrison, and drummer Ringo Starr.
